Structure fire reported in basement near Burnside StLancaster NH

Heads up: This post was detected from real-time dispatch audio. Information may be incomplete, and the situation may evolve. Always verify using official agency releases.

audio iconFire & Arson
Burnside St, Lancaster, NH 03584

A fire was reported in the basement of a residence near Burnside Street in Lancaster. Multiple fire departments were dispatched to the scene.
